Fairhill House Hotel, Clonbur
Overview
Located nearly a 10-minute ride from The Quiet Man Museum, the 3-star Fairhill House Hotel Clonbur offers Wi-Fi throughout the property and a car park.
Location
This Clonbur hotel offers a picturesque location a 60-minute drive from Connemara airport. The Guinness Tower is also situated 4.8 km away.
There is Ashford Castle approximately a 15-minute ride away.
Rooms
The hotel features 20 rooms equipped with a multi-channel TV as well as tea and coffee making equipment. Ironing facilities are featured for guests' comfort. Offering such amenities as shower caps and bath sheets, the bathrooms also include a bathtub, a power shower, and an additional toilet. You can enjoy views of the surrounding countryside.
Eat & Drink
Breakfast is served every morning with breakfast bars and fresh fruits. This Clonbur property has the lounge bar with free wireless internet and live music. The bar area includes a lounge.
Leisure & Business
Additionally, staying at the Fairhill House Clonbur, active guests can enjoy a golf club on site. This Clonbur hotel also features complimentary wireless internet access and safes for those arriving on business.
